Churchyard, C., et al., 2011. The Cost of Community Services in the Township of Cavan Monaghan: A literature review on the fiscal impacts of land use for municipalities in Ontario, Canada.
Arthur Churchyard, M.Sc., Dr. Wayne Caldwell, RPP, MCIP School of Environmental Design and Rural Development University of Guelph. With input from Dr. Yolande Chan Past Director, The Monieson Centre at Queen’s School of Business Queen's University September 2011.
At the first public meeting of the Cavan Monaghan Official Plan (OP) review consultation (May 6, 2009), community members asked for a fiscal impact analysis to be conducted as part of the OP review process. The suggestion was that fiscal responsibility should be used as a governance principle in the allocation of land uses in the Township. Community members identified a need to balance business (commercial/industrial) development with residential development. Agriculture was also discussed as an important component of the local economy. This led to the identification of at least three major issues related to the fiscal costs and benefits of different land uses. The literature review examines existing documents and academic literature with a goal of providing a series of observations and conclusions that would be relevant for rural Ontario municipalities. In particular these findings help to identify the relative revenues and expenses associated with different land uses. The literature review is intended to contribute to more informed decision-making, particularly at the stage of developing an Official Plan.
Heidenreich, B., 2011. The Value of Trees:
Making the case for tree protection.
Compiled by Barbara Heidenreich for the Ontario Urban Forest Council www.oufc.org updated January 2011. A “case” for preserving trees sometimes has to be made. Fortunately there is extensive research already undertaken in documenting the environmental, social and economic benefits of trees and nature. The broad range of benefits that trees contribute, sometimes known as the “total economic value (TEV)”, is provided and references are appended that offer more details as to the value of trees.
Ceci, B. 2023. Overview of the Baxter Creek Provincial Water Quality Monitoring Network: A Study for the Baxter Creek Watershed Alliance (BCWA).
School of the Environment In association with the Baxter Creek Watershed Alliance April 2023. Version 1.0. A baseline Baxter Creek stream water quality trend analysis was conducted as the first step of a multi-step, multi-year study that will inform the Baxter Creek Watershed Alliance’s long-term watershed research study. The goal of this project was to collect raw data for nutrients that indicate water quality including phosphorus (P), nitrogen (N), sodium (Na), and chloride (Cl), as well as measured dissolved oxygen (DO) content, to produce information on the water quality of Baxter Creek.
